@57captain57: Legionella bacteria thrive and multiply optimally in warm water temperatures ranging between 77°F and 113°F (with the absolute highest growth peaking between 90°F and 105°F). Temperatures at or very near 78°F place the water directly into the danger zone where the bacteria can grow rapidly
